Secrecy by Witness-Functions on Increasing Protocols
Jaouhar Fattahi, Mohamed Mejri, Hanane Houmani

TL;DR
This paper introduces a novel formal method for static analysis of cryptographic protocols to ensure secrecy, by verifying that the security level of each component does not decrease during protocol execution.
Contribution
It presents a new witness-function-based approach for analyzing protocol secrecy and applies it to an amended Woo-Lam protocol as a case study.
Findings
The method successfully verifies secrecy properties of the analyzed protocol.
It detects potential security level reductions in protocol components.
The approach provides a systematic way to ensure protocol secrecy.
Abstract
In this paper, we present a new formal method to analyze cryptographic protocols statically for the property of secrecy. It consists in inspecting the level of security of every component in the protocol and making sure that it does not diminish during its life cycle. If yes, it concludes that the protocol keeps its secret inputs. We analyze in this paper an amended version of the Woo-Lam protocol using this new method.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
